I was back to Bourne Heath again on 10 February to judge at Karen Denton’s Level 3 and 4 trials. I shared the judging with Liz Ormerod so even though the weather was very mixed we had an enjoyable day.

Level 3. There were some lovely searches. I started with boxes and luggage. As usual this caught some teams out, especially a bag, with gun oil. It does seem to be the least favourite out of the four searches.
I then judges exterior search. Quite a few dogs didn’t like the surface of the area, some trying to eat it, others rolling in it but we finished with good results.

Worthy winners, Jill and Herbie, followed by felicity and Dannie Dario, and third place to Carol and Fiddle. Well done to everyone who qualified. Special congratulations to Felicity for attaining her Excellence award.

Level 4. Tables and chairs and the perimeter. Distractions were out and hardly any dogs knocked them. Some very impressive teams.

Vehicle search. There were some awsome teams. It was blowing a gale and raining. The teams that did the best were the one where the owners listened to their dogs. It was a line of 3 cars, with both scents being on the last car. Most impressive was Janet and Jess. Jess set off straight down the line to the last car with Janet in hot pursuit. Jess found the scents in 43 seconds. Janet trusted Jess and she was rewarded. Sarah and Hugo was a similar search. Both teams were delighted.

Sarah and Hugo won level 4, next were Kate and kiwi and Janet and Jess were third.
